This is a helper macro to loop through all the usable page sizes for a high-granularity-enabled HugeTLB VMA. Given the VMA's hstate, it will loop, in descending order, through the page sizes that HugeTLB supports for this architecture; it always includes PAGE_SIZE.
Signed-off-by: James Houghton <jthoughton@google.com> --- mm/hugetlb.c | 10 ++++++++++ 1 file changed, 10 insertions(+)
diff --git a/mm/hugetlb.c b/mm/hugetlb.c index 8b10b941458d..557b0afdb503 100644 --- a/mm/hugetlb.c +++ b/mm/hugetlb.c @@ -6989,6 +6989,16 @@ bool hugetlb_hgm_enabled(struct vm_area_struct *vma) /* All shared VMAs have HGM enabled. */ return vma->vm_flags & VM_SHARED; } +static unsigned int __shift_for_hstate(struct hstate *h) +{ + if (h >= &hstates[hugetlb_max_hstate]) + return PAGE_SHIFT; + return huge_page_shift(h); +} +#define for_each_hgm_shift(hstate, tmp_h, shift) \ + for ((tmp_h) = hstate; (shift) = __shift_for_hstate(tmp_h), \ + (tmp_h) <= &hstates[hugetlb_max_hstate]; \ + (tmp_h)++) #endif /* CONFIG_HUGETLB_HIGH_GRANULARITY_MAPPING */ /* -- 2.37.0.rc0.161.g10f37bed90-goog
